| Job Title: | Substitute Teacher (Blind/Deaf) |
| Post Date: | June 20, 2012 |
| Apply by: | Continuous Recruitment |
| Job ID: | Part-Time, Hourly |
| Location: | Atlanta Area School for the Deaf, 890 North Indian Creek Drive, Clarkston, GA 30021 |
| Program/Unit: | State Schools/Office of Policy and External Affairs |
| Description of Duties: | Provides a comprehensive educational of instruction to students who are hearing impaired. Responsibilities include assessing and documenting students' communication skills, functional reading/math skills, independent living skills, and educational/behavioral development; identifying appropriate individualized educational goals; developing and implementing instructional lesson plans; maintaining documentation of student progress; and utilizing appropriate instructional techniques based on individual student needs. |
| Minimum Qualifications: | High School Diploma or GED and four hours of initial substitute teacher training provided by a local education agency in Georgia, and sign language proficiency at the "Intermediate Level" as measured by the Sign Communication Proficiency Instrument. |
| Preferred Qualifications: | Preference will be given to applicants who, in addition to meeting the minimum qualifications, possess one or more of the following: • Bachelor’s Degree • Valid or expired professional teaching certificate at level 4 or higher (or letter of eligibility for the same) • Completion of at least one or more years of post-secondary training beyond a high school diploma ranked in order of number of years completed • Sign language proficiency at the "Advanced Level" as measured by the Sign Communication Instrument.
|
| Salary/Benefits: | Part-time, hourly position with no benefits. Hourly pay rate is $9.00 - $18.00 commensurate with education level and employment experience. |
